use crate::engine::InstantMillis;
use crate::wire::DestinationHash;
pub const PATH_REQUEST_MIN_INTERVAL_MS: u64 = 20 * 1_000;
pub trait RecentPathRequestTable {
fn capacity(&self) -> usize;
fn len(&self) -> usize;
fn is_empty(&self) -> bool {
self.len() == 0
}
fn destinations(&self) -> &[DestinationHash];
fn requested_ats(&self) -> &[InstantMillis];
fn push(&mut self, destination: DestinationHash, requested_at: InstantMillis);
fn swap_remove(&mut self, index: usize);
fn index_of(&self, destination: &DestinationHash) -> Option<usize> {
self.destinations()
.iter()
.position(|candidate| candidate == destination)
}
fn first_stale(&mut self, now: InstantMillis) -> Option<usize> {
self.requested_ats()
.iter()
.position(|requested_at| aged_out(*requested_at, now))
}
fn prefers_linear_stale_cull(&mut self, _now: InstantMillis) -> bool {
true
}
fn invalidate_stale_index(&mut self) {}
}
#[derive(Debug, Default)]
pub struct RecentPathRequests<C: RecentPathRequestTable> {
table: C,
}
impl<C: RecentPathRequestTable> RecentPathRequests<C> {
pub fn mark_seen_at(&mut self, destination: DestinationHash, now: InstantMillis) {
if let Some(index) = self.index_of(&destination) {
self.table.swap_remove(index);
}
self.evict_stale(now);
if self.table.len() >= self.table.capacity() {
self.evict_oldest();
}
self.table.push(destination, now);
}
pub fn is_throttled(&self, destination: &DestinationHash, now: InstantMillis) -> bool {
self.index_of(destination)
.is_some_and(|index| !aged_out(self.table.requested_ats()[index], now))
}
fn index_of(&self, destination: &DestinationHash) -> Option<usize> {
self.table.index_of(destination)
}
fn evict_stale(&mut self, now: InstantMillis) {
if self.table.prefers_linear_stale_cull(now) {
self.table.invalidate_stale_index();
let mut index = 0;
while index < self.table.len() {
if aged_out(self.table.requested_ats()[index], now) {
self.table.swap_remove(index);
} else {
index += 1;
}
}
return;
}
while let Some(index) = self.table.first_stale(now) {
self.table.swap_remove(index);
}
}
fn evict_oldest(&mut self) {
let Some(index) = self
.table
.requested_ats()
.iter()
.enumerate()
.min_by_key(|(_, requested_at)| requested_at.0)
.map(|(index, _)| index)
else {
return;
};
self.table.swap_remove(index);
}
pub fn len(&self) -> usize {
self.table.len()
}
pub fn is_empty(&self) -> bool {
self.table.is_empty()
}
}
fn aged_out(requested_at: InstantMillis, now: InstantMillis) -> bool {
now.0.saturating_sub(requested_at.0) >= PATH_REQUEST_MIN_INTERVAL_MS
}
